Output 6663afb448a99616e6a6d53ea3a54ef7a2dfc3d8f3f5f55f93c63f50f725ef89:1

value
114683504
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e21befacdfef5f826f0d6fa034cffced168dd161 OP_EQUALVERIFY OP_CHECKSIG
address
1McZBQ2mG1tsrdYRhukK9g5bPUDgFnzg6c
transaction
6663afb448a99616e6a6d53ea3a54ef7a2dfc3d8f3f5f55f93c63f50f725ef89
spent
true